JavaScript 操作键盘的Enter事件(键盘任何事件),兼容多浏览器
废话少说,代码上来: 实现代码如下: document.onkeydown=function() { var EventUtil = {}; EventUtil.getEvent = function(){ if(window.event){return window.event;} else{
废话少说,代码上来: 实现代码如下: document.onkeydown=function() { var EventUtil = {}; EventUtil.getEvent = function(){ if(window.event){return window.event;} else{
html标签: 服务器控件: 用FileUpload经常要禁止手动输入:
html标签: 服务器控件: 用FileUpload经常要禁止手动输入:
实现代码如下: function window.onhelp(){return false} //屏蔽F1帮助 /*keyCod从113-123分别禁用了F2-F12键,13禁用了回车键(Enter),8禁用了退格键(BackSpace)*/ document.onkeydown = functio
判断是否按下的为回车非常简单: 实现代码如下: function EnterPress(){ if(event.keyCode == 13){ ... } }IE6的onkeypress会接受"回车事件",而onkeydown不会接受 IE8的onkeypress不会接受"回车事件",而onkeyd
判断是否按下的为回车非常简单: 实现代码如下: function EnterPress(){ if(event.keycode == 13){ ... } }IE6的onkeypress会接受"回车事件",而onkeydown不会接受 IE8的onkeypress不会接受"回车事件",而onkeyd
demo: function FCKeditor_OnComplete( editorInstance ) { editorInstance.EditorDocument.attachEvent("onkeydown", editor_keydown); editorInstance.EditorD
主要分四个部分第一部分:浏览器的按键事件第二部分:兼容浏览器第三部分:代码实现和优化第四部分:总结第一部分:浏览器的按键事件用js实现键盘记录,要关注浏览器的三种按键事件类型,即keydown,keypress和keyup,它们分别对应onkeydown、onkeypress和onkeyup这三个事
1、挂接事件,比如onkeydown事件,要在FCKeditor_OnComplete里实现: 实现代码如下: function FCKeditor_OnComplete( editorInstance ) { if (document.all) // IE editorInstance.Edito
整体思路是这样,当文本框的值改变时触发事件,对列表中原有的值进行过滤。 根据这个思路,首先需要解决的无非是确定文本框的什么事件可以满足要求,当时第一个想到的是onkeydown或者onkeypress,在试的过程中发现再输入中文时,无法响应,因为输入方会将焦点给屏蔽了。在网上寻觅了一会发现onpro